Decoding the Modern Metrics That Matter
Historically, download speed was the sole metric users cared about. As of 2026, the rise of real-time spatial computing, 8K streaming, and AI-driven cloud processing has shifted the focus to upload rates and latency. When you launch an internet speed test, you are measuring three primary metrics: download speed, upload speed, and ping (or jitter).
High jitter can ruin live gaming and video conferencing even if your raw download speed looks impressive. Legacy speed testing platforms often struggle to accurately benchmark the newer Wi-Fi 7 and 10 Gbps fiber lines emerging this year, making tool selection critical. If your test tool relies on outdated single-thread TCP connections, it will likely report speeds far below your physical line capacity.
Step-by-Step Guide to Eliminating Test Bottlenecks
To get an honest reading of your incoming bandwidth, you must isolate your testing environment from internal network congestion. Local hardware bottlenecks—like an older network card or a crowded Wi-Fi channel—frequently masquerade as ISP throttling.
Follow these critical steps before clicking "Go" on your next test:
- Ditch the Wi-Fi: Always use a Cat6a or Cat8 Ethernet cable connected directly to your router to measure true incoming speed.
- Close Background Applications: Disable bandwidth-heavy apps, active cloud backups, and VPNs, which heavily throttle test performance.
- Test at Multiple Nodes: Run tests using different local and regional servers to ensure the bottleneck isn't on the testing host's side.
- Clear Browser Cache: Browser overhead can skew web-based test results; consider using dedicated desktop or command-line speed test applications for speeds over 1 Gbps.

Next-Gen Networks and the Shift to Quality of Experience
As we progress through 2026, the telecommunications industry is moving away from raw megabits per second toward Quality of Experience (QoE) metrics. New testing protocols are being designed to measure "loaded latency"—how your ping behaves when the network is under heavy load, such as when one family member streams while another plays games.
With satellite mega-constellations expanding global coverage and ISPs pushing the boundaries of physical infrastructure, your weekly internet speed test remains the most powerful consumer tool to ensure you get what you pay for. Keep a log of your results over several days to build a solid case if you need to contact customer support for a refund or line check.
